What grilles are those on The Vee's G? The ones either side of the chrome Mitsubishi logo? Or are those custom made?
Probably custom made the same way people do the grill like on mine. Cut out the fins, form some gutter mesh, glue it in place.

Techn0 it's really easy...and with the correct tools it doesn't take more than a few hours. Dremel tool with a cutoff bit or saw blade, little sand paper, paint, mesh, hot glue...that's it really. Some bondo/body filler if you mess up the cutting
